Portland is one of the leading craft beer cities in the United States, known for hop-forward IPAs, lagers, and experimental small-batch brews from many local breweries.
Portland has a major specialty coffee culture focused on carefully sourced beans, precise brewing, and independent roasters that helped define the city’s daily food ritual.
Portland-style doughnuts became nationally famous through creative toppings, oversized shapes, and quirky flavors, making them a recognizable local sweet treat.

Moderate by U.S. city standards. Food and coffee are reasonable, but hotels and fine dining can be pricey in peak season.
Tip 18-20% at restaurants; 20%+ for great service. Tip USD 1-2 per drink at bars, round up taxis, and tip hotel staff USD 2-5.
